Each party will <br />notify the other immediately of any changes of address that would require any notice or <br />delivery to be directed to another address. <br /> <br />17. Conflict of Interest. City will evaluate Consultant's duties pursuant to this Agreement <br />to determine whether disclosure under the Political Reform Act and City's Conflict of Interest <br />Code is required of Consultant or any of Consultant's employees, agents, or subcontractors. <br />Should it be determined that disclosure is required, Consultant or Consultant's affected <br />employees, agents, or subcontractors will complete and file with the City Clerk those <br />schedules specified by City and contained in the Statement of Economic Interests Form 700. <br /> <br />Consultant, for Consultant and on behalf of Consultant's agents, employees, subcontractors <br />and consultants warrants that by execution of this Agreement, that they have no interest, <br />present or contemplated, in the projects affected by this Agreement. Consultant further <br />warrants that neither Consultant, nor Consultant's agents, employees, subcontractors and <br />consultants have any ancillary real property, business interests or income that will be affected <br />by this Agreement or, alternatively, that Consultant will file with the City an affidavit disclosing <br />this interest. <br /> <br />18. General Compliance with Laws. Consultant will keep fully informed of federal, state <br />and local laws and ordinances and regulations which in any manner affect those employed by <br />Consultant, or in any way affect the performance of the Services by Consultant. Consultant <br />will at all times observe and comply with these laws, ordinances, and regulations and will be <br />responsible for the compliance of Consultant's Services with all applicable laws, ordinances <br />and regulations. <br /> <br />19. Discrimination and Harassment Prohibited. Consultant will comply with all applicable <br />local, state and federal laws and regulations prohibiting discrimination and harassment. <br /> <br />20. Termination. In the event of the Consultant's failure to prosecute, deliver, or perform <br />the Services, City may terminate this Agreement for nonperformance by notifying Consultant <br />in writing pursuant to the notice provisions of this Agreement.
